Subject: Session-token refresh fix — please eyeball before cut

Hey release folks, quick one: Marisol tracked down the bug where Quillbase silently dropped refresh attempts after a clock skew over 90 seconds. The fix retries with server time and backs off cleanly. I'd love a second pair of eyes on the retry loop before we tag the candidate. The build that includes the patch is identified below.

session token of fawep-tajep = htk14_4221f8eaf43a2f

FINANCE REVIEW SUMMARY — Board

Subject: Calderwyn Foods expansion into the Vastermark region.

Entry costs tracking 4% under budget. Distribution agreement with Norrgate Supply executed. Payback modelled at 30 months; sensitivity runs hold under downside volume assumptions. Staffing plan approved; regulatory filings on schedule. No change to capital request. Recommendation: proceed as planned. The strategic note below is for board eyes only.

board note of hawif-kadug: Holethek Partners is in early talks to buy Rusokek Foods for about $62.0 million. The Quenius launch date is June 15, and nothing goes to the press before then.

## Deploying the Gatewick Proctor Queue

Deploys are pretty painless: push to main, wait for the pipeline, then watch the queue drain dashboard for five minutes. If candidates pile up mid-exam, roll back first and ask questions later — the queue replays safely. Everything the workers care about lives in one config block, shown here for reference.

settings of bafof-yagef:
JOROX_PIN=8740
JOROX_TENANT=pelox
JOROX_METRICS_HOST=metrics.jorox.qorvelworks.internal
JOROX_SEAL=seal_c78f63c1
JOROX_STANDBY_TEAM=norax

Heads up on the pooling change in `db/pool.ts` — looks good overall, but I'd hold the merge until Brightloom staging soaks overnight. The new Wellspring pool reuses connections more aggressively, and the idle reaper now runs on its own timer, so we should watch for stale-handle errors under low traffic. Nothing blocking from my side. For the release notes, the settings we're shipping are listed below.

tuning constants:
QUOTAS = {
    "druwyn": 5,
    "holix": 5,
    "zorath": 5,
    "holwyn": 10,
}